Uganda Taxi Operators & Drivers' Association Vs Uganda Revenue Authority
Uganda Taxi Operators & Drivers' Association Vs Uganda Revenue Authority (Civil Appeal No. 15 of 2013) [2015] UGCA 50 (15 June 2015)
The Court found that the management of taxi operations and taxi parks by the appellant was incidental to the principal service of passenger transport, and therefore exempt from VAT under the law as it stood prior to the 2011 amendment. The Court relied on statutory interpretation and persuasive case law to conclude that such services, when provided as part of a composite supply and not charged separately, should not be artificially split for VAT purposes.
